• State PEMUDAH
The core function of PEMUDAH (which stands for a “special taskforce to facilitate business”) is specifically to support businesses in the country through minimising bureacracy and speeding up approvals. Through the state Pemudah, investors can experience a fast access to government departments and expedited work processes e.g. handling visas for expatriates through the Immigration Department or processing stamp duty for land transfers.
• Promotion of Investment, Trade and Services Industry
Once the largest tin producer in the world, Perak is today targeting development in four basic industries sectors – resource based, non-resource based, service based and halal based. InvestPerak is striving to promote these industries across the globe, in order to attract investment and develop these businesses to help the growth of the state's economy.
